    X-Blades is a competent action game, but it lacks the fine touch that could have made it something special. It just cannot seem to make the most of its solid backbone. The diverse combat is too often made one-dimensional, the impressive visuals lack variety, and the imposing bosses are pushovers.     You'd think that there's not a lot to expect from a game like this. A Devil May Cry clone with a half-dressed chick swinging two huge gun-swords around killing things. Seems like a sure thing. And yet, it fails to deliver. The game tries to hide the half-baked level design by making you stand in place while monsters respawn until you kill enough to close the portal, just to stretch things out in a room roughly the size of a mens' bathroom stall.
